Dublin Zoo

The zoo was founded in 1830. In the 1980s, early 1990s a campaign was run to try and have the zoo closed because of its generally dilapidated and cramped conditions for the animals, many of whom exhibited signs of stress, Recent investment has resulted in a huge expansion of space and facilities for the animals. The zoo boasts of having bred the famous MGM lion.
